What axis is the axis of symmetry on?
cluponka [151]
The axis of symmetry of a parabola is a vertical line that divides the parabola into two congruent halves. The axis of symmetry always passes through the vertex of the parabola. The x -coordinate of the vertex is the equation of the axis of symmetry of the parabola.
